Designed for applications requiring very small size and high isolation levels, the E200I series is a family of low- cost, ultra-miniature, 2W dc/dc converters. Eighteen models operate from inputs of 5, 12, 24 or 48 Vdc, with single outputs of 3.3, 5, 9, 12 or 15 Vdc. Input/output isolation of all models is 3,000 Vdc, and efficiency is as high as 84%. The MTBF, calculated per MIL HDBK 217F, of the series is 2.7 Mhours. Measuring 0.46" x 0.29" x 0.4", the family comes in a single-in line-package. Each model is specified for operation over the wide industrial temperature range of -40°C to +85°C with no derating or heat sinking required. Cooling is by free-air convection. Applications include industrial control systems, test instrumentation, telecommunications equipment and datacomm equipment. MICROPOWER DIRECT, Stoughton, MA. (781) 344-8226.
